Issue
ISSUE

The existing Fire and Emergency Management Programmable Logic Controller (F&EM PLC) and Emergency Management Panel (EMP) systems on Metro B&D lines are obsolete and have been phased out by the original equipment manufacturer (Schneider Electric). The affected stations are from Wilshire/Vermont to Wilshire/Western (three stations), Vermont/Beverly to Hollywood/Vine (five stations), Hollywood/Highland to North Hollywood (three stations) and two satellite locations, Solar Drive and Hortense Street. Spare parts are only available as refurbished, and Schneider Electric has recommended that the equipment be migrated to the current generation of PLC equipment. The F&EM PLC is a mission-critical system and is required by Fire Life Safety (FLS) Regulation 4 to be in proper working condition.

Background
BACKGROUND

The currently installed PLC and EMP equipment is between 25-29 years old and has been in place since the Metro B&D lines were commissioned in four phased segments:
* Segment 1 - Union Station to Westlake/MacArthur (5 stations)
* Segment 2a - Wilshire/Vermont Station to Wilshire/Western Station (3 Stations)
* Segment 2b - Vermont/Beverly Station to Hollywood/Vine Station (5 Stations)
* Segment 3 - Hollywood/Highland Station to North Hollywood Station (3 Stations)
